FaunaDB
- Keeping an existing Fauna-backed application alive on self-hosted infrastructure while a migration is planned and fundednot DataGrip
- Extracting historical data from a Fauna dataset that can no longer be reached through the hosted APInot DataGrip
- Studying a production implementation of deterministic distributed transactions, since the full server source is now readable under Apache 2.0not DataGrip
- Forking the engine deliberately, where an organisation has JVM and distributed-systems staff and wants a document-relational store it fully controlsnot DataGrip
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
DataGrip
- Commercial use requires a paid subscription; the free tier is non-commercial only.
- No built-in database administration features like backup scheduling found in dedicated DBA tools.
- Heavier resource footprint than lightweight single-purpose SQL clients.
- NoSQL support (e.g. MongoDB) is less mature than its relational database tooling.
FaunaDB
- The hosted service was wound down in 2025, so there is no managed Fauna to buy; every remaining user either operates a JVM cluster themselves or migrates, and both are projects rather than tasks.
- The open-sourced repository has had no substantive activity since May 2025 and the drivers were frozen alongside it, so you inherit responsibility for security patches in a Scala distributed database that almost nobody else is running.
- FQL has no wire or dialect compatibility with anything else, so migrating off is a rewrite of every query, index and access rule in the application rather than a data export.
- No BI tool, ORM or CDC connector speaks FQL, so reporting and analytics always required exporting the data first, and that export tooling is now also unmaintained.
- The community was small before the shutdown and has dispersed since, so operational answers, tuning advice and people who have run a Fauna cluster in anger are all scarce when something breaks.

Answered from the vendors’ own pages
DataGrip: Is DataGrip free for personal use?
JetBrains introduced a free non-commercial license for DataGrip in October 2025, allowing personal use, while commercial use still requires a paid annual or monthly subscription.
SourceFaunaDB: Can I still sign up for Fauna as a service?
No. Fauna Inc. wound down the hosted service in 2025 and the company website is no longer serving. The only way to run Fauna now is to build and operate the open-sourced server yourself.
DataGrip: Who qualifies for the free non-commercial license?
Only individuals are eligible, for uses like learning, open-source work, or content creation. Anyone paid by an employer, including at a non-profit, must use a commercial license instead.
SourceFaunaDB: What licence is the open-sourced code under?
Apache 2.0, with the copyright held by a FaunaDB Foundation. That is a permissive OSI licence with no competing-use clause, so you may run it, modify it and even offer it as a service.
DataGrip: How long does the free non-commercial license last?
It lasts one year and auto-renews if DataGrip was used at least once in the final six months; otherwise you can simply reapply for a new license.
SourceFaunaDB: Is the open source version the same software that ran the cloud?
It is the core database engine. The control plane, billing, dashboard and multi-tenant operational tooling that made it a service are not part of the release, so you are running the engine, not the product.
DataGrip: Does the free license have fewer features than the paid version?
No, it is a full-featured IDE identical to the paid version, though it requires anonymized telemetry sharing that cannot be opted out of under the non-commercial agreement.
SourceFaunaDB: What should I migrate to?
There is no drop-in target. Teams that valued the document model with relationships usually land on Postgres with JSONB, and teams that valued the serverless HTTP access pattern usually land on DynamoDB or a managed Postgres with an HTTP driver. Either way the query layer is rewritten.
DataGrip: Can I use DataGrip offline with the free license?
No, activation requires logging into a JetBrains Account; offline activation codes are not available for the free non-commercial license.
SourceFaunaDB: How hard is it to self-host?
It builds as a fat JAR and runs as a multi-node JVM cluster. There is an OPERATING.md, but no supported packaging, no operator, no upstream releases and no support contract, so budget for a distributed-systems engineer, not a container.
